Bidirection switching device S11, S12, S13;S21、S22、S23;S31, S32, S33 are common just like Fig. 3, Fig. 4, Fig. 5, Fig. 6
Four kinds of different structures, the common collector two-way power switch that wherein Fig. 3 is made up of 2 fly-wheel diodes and 2 IGBT is former
Reason figure, the common emitter two-way power switch schematic diagram that Fig. 4 is made up of 2 fly-wheel diodes and 2 IGBT, Fig. 5 is by 4
The bridge-type two-way power switch schematic diagram that diode and 1 IGBT and 1 fly-wheel diode form, Fig. 6 is made up of 2 IGBT
Reverse blocking IGBT two-way power switch schematic diagram.

The operation principle of the present invention is as follows: use ripe matrix converter control algolithm to control directly series connection three
Phase three-phase matrixing matrix array.The input electricity of each series connection three-phase three-phase matrixing unit in matrix array
Pressure amplitude value and phase place are completely the same, use identical modulation matrix simultaneously, it is ensured that during every the most directly series connection, its voltage magnitude is identical,
Phase place is identical.So, after inlet wire high tension voltage is by filtering, through blood pressure lowering, then by three-phase three-phase matrixing list
After the modulation of unit's model identical, generate the three-phase alternating current sinusoidal voltage that amplitude is consistent with phase place, direct through isolating transformer
Series connection, is superimposed as the high pressure three-phase alternating voltage of phase invariant amplitude superposition at double.Owing to this high voltage converter uses matrix battle array
Row, use same phase is with the low voltage three-phase sinusoidal voltage superposition of amplitude simultaneously, and also inlet wire filtering and low-voltage filter
Link, so output voltage waveforms is almost without distortion, output voltage be amplitude and the continuously adjustable three-phase alternating current of frequency sinusoidal
Voltage, input current is three-phase alternating current sinusoidal current, and voltage, current harmonics are little, and du/dt is the least, power factor close to 1, energy
Amount can two-way flow, can four quadrant running, can directly drive mesohigh ac motor.Internal without rectifying and wave-filtering link, no
Needing jumbo electrochemical capacitor or self-healing electric capacity, system inversion efficiency is high.In sum, the three-phase of directly connecting of the present invention
Matrix form medium-high voltage frequency converter can be applied in mesohigh driving by A.C.motor field, including 2 quadrants, 4 quadrants of motor
Run, soft start runs, it is adaptable to high-power application scenario, has that system power factor is high, can run with 4 quadrants, defeated
Go out that voltage harmonic content is low, the continuously adjustable feature of output voltage amplitude frequency.
